Description
Once you've barely escaped death, can life ever be the same?
On a train journey, an American writer meets Yogesh, a yoga teacher with a story to tell. It's about Krish, Tony, and Asif - three friends who survived a plane hijack on their trip to Goa. Krish, a driven entrepreneur; Tony, an alcoholic dropout; and Asif, a carefree music lover, get a newfound gratitude after the incident.
The friends decide to find purpose and seek their most authentic selves. From the ghats of Varanasi to the mountains of Tibet to the deserts of Afghanistan, they experience life-altering revelations.
But as the story nears the end, the writer wonders - how are these lives connected to Yogesh?
And what is truly real?
